# 18d86965 18-Apr-2024 Paulo Alcantara <pc@manguebit.com>

smb: client: fix rename(2) regression against samba

After commit 2c7d399e551c ("smb: client: reuse file lease key in
compound operations") the client started reusing lease keys for
rename, unlink and set path size operations to prevent it from
breaking its own leases and thus causing unnecessary lease breaks to
same connection.

The implementation relies on positive dentries and
cifsInodeInfo::lease_granted to decide whether reusing lease keys for
the compound requests. cifsInodeInfo::lease_granted was introduced by
commit 0ab95c2510b6 ("Defer close only when lease is enabled.") to
indicate whether lease caching is granted for a specific file, but
that can only happen until file is open, so
cifsInodeInfo::lease_granted was left uninitialised in ->alloc_inode
and then client started sending random lease keys for files that
hadn't any leases.

This fixes the following test case against samba:

mount.cifs //srv/share /mnt/1 -o ...,nosharesock
mount.cifs //srv/share /mnt/2 -o ...,nosharesock
touch /mnt/1/foo; tail -f /mnt/1/foo & pid=$!
mv /mnt/2/foo /mnt/2/bar # fails with -EIO
kill $pid

# 100ccd18 24-Nov-2023 David Howells <dhowells@redhat.com>

netfs: Optimise away reads above the point at which there can be no data

Track the file position above which the server is not expected to have any
data (the "zero point") and preemptively assume that we can satisfy
requests by filling them with zeroes locally rather than attempting to
download them if they're over that line - even if we've written data back
to the server. Assume that any data that was written back above that
position is held in the local cache. Note that we have to split requests
that straddle the line.

Make use of this to optimise away some reads from the server. We need to
set the zero point in the following circumstances:

(1) When we see an extant remote inode and have no cache for it, we set
the zero_point to i_size.

(2) On local inode creation, we set zero_point to 0.

(3) On local truncation down, we reduce zero_point to the new i_size if
the new i_size is lower.

(4) On local truncation up, we don't change zero_point.

(5) On local modification, we don't change zero_point.

(6) On remote invalidation, we set zero_point to the new i_size.

(7) If stored data is discarded from the pagecache or culled from fscache,
we must set zero_point above that if the data also got written to the
server.

(8) If dirty data is written back to the server, but not fscache, we must
set zero_point above that.

(9) If a direct I/O write is made, set zero_point above that.

Assuming the above, any read from the server at or above the zero_point
position will return all zeroes.

The zero_point value can be stored in the cache, provided the above rules
are applied to it by any code that culls part of the local cache.

# c54fc3a4 30-Nov-2023 David Howells <dhowells@redhat.com>

cifs: Fix flushing, invalidation and file size with FICLONE

Fix a number of issues in the cifs filesystem implementation of the FICLONE
ioctl in cifs_remap_file_range(). This is analogous to the previously
fixed bug in cifs_file_copychunk_range() and can share the helper
functions.

Firstly, the invalidation of the destination range is handled incorrectly:
We shouldn't just invalidate the whole file as dirty data in the file may
get lost and we can't just call truncate_inode_pages_range() to invalidate
the destination range as that will erase parts of a partial folio at each
end whilst invalidating and discarding all the folios in the middle. We
need to force all the folios covering the range to be reloaded, but we
mustn't lose dirty data in them that's not in the destination range.

Further, we shouldn't simply round out the range to PAGE_SIZE at each end
as cifs should move to support multipage folios.

Secondly, there's an issue whereby a write may have extended the file
locally, but not have been written back yet. This can leaves the local
idea of the EOF at a later point than the server's EOF. If a clone request
is issued, this will fail on the server with STATUS_INVALID_VIEW_SIZE
(which gets translated to -EIO locally) if the clone source extends past
the server's EOF.

Fix this by:

(0) Flush the source region (already done). The flush does nothing and
the EOF isn't moved if the source region has no dirty data.

(1) Move the EOF to the end of the source region if it isn't already at
least at this point. If we can't do this, for instance if the server
doesn't support it, just flush the entire source file.

(2) Find the folio (if present) at each end of the range, flushing it and
increasing the region-to-be-invalidated to cover those in their
entirety.

(3) Fully discard all the folios covering the range as we want them to be
reloaded.

(4) Then perform the extent duplication.

Thirdly, set i_size after doing the duplicate_extents operation as this
value may be used by various things internally. stat() hides the issue
because setting ->time to 0 causes cifs_getatr() to revalidate the
attributes.

These were causing the cifs/001 xfstest to fail.

# 238b351d 30-Aug-2023 Steve French <stfrench@microsoft.com>

smb3: allow controlling length of time directory entries are cached with dir leases

Currently with directory leases we cache directory contents for a fixed period
of time (default 30 seconds) but for many workloads this is too short. Allow
configuring the maximum amount of time directory entries are cached when a
directory lease is held on that directory. Add module load parm "max_dir_cache"

For example to set the timeout to 10 minutes you would do:

echo 600 > /sys/module/cifs/parameters/dir_cache_timeout

or to disable caching directory contents:

echo 0 > /sys/module/cifs/parameters/dir_cache_timeout
